Followed Julia on social media @juleselbaba . --- Send in a voice message: https://anchor.fm/julesonthehustle/message2022-05-0635 minJules on the HustleJules on the HustleElina Svitolina: Neutralizing Russian FlagsJulia speaks with Ukraine's Elina Svitolina prior to her match in Monterrey. She said she would not step foot on a tennis court if there was any Russian or Belarusian representation on the other side of the net. The 27-year-old ranked No. 15 in the world, was the top seed in the WTA 250 in Monterrey, Mexico, and was “shocked” to have drawn Russia’s Anastasia Potapova in the first round of the event. Here we break down her emotions and how she got the WTA to neutralize the flags.
